### Pagination (excerpt — Corvid Public API design doc)

Cursor-based pagination protects the Corvid API from deep-offset scans that degraded the Hallows cluster last spring. On-call engineers should know that page-size caps and cursor TTLs are enforced server-side; clients exceeding them receive a descriptive 400, not a truncated page. The enforced limits are defined below.

limits module of hahap-yafog:
THRESHOLDS = {
    "weneth": 555,
    "jorix": 223,
    "eliius": 753,
}

## Build provenance — FeedFettle validator

Quick note for reviewers: every release of the FeedFettle podcast feed validator is built in the hermetic Oakhollow pipeline, so what you review is exactly what ships. No local builds, no manual uploads — the pipeline signs the artifact and records its lineage. When checking a binary, match it against the provenance record using the build token shown below.

pipeline stamp: htk9_6ce9d33c5

### Banner Timing for Third-Party Plugins

The Lanternly consent banner must render before any plugin initializes storage. Plugin authors should assume their init hook fires only after consent state resolves, and should treat an unresolved state as denial. To keep first paint acceptable, the rollout staggers banner delivery by region and caches consent decisions locally. The timing budgets and cache lifetimes your plugins must respect are defined below.

tuning constants:
QUOTAS = {
    "druwyn": 5,
    "holix": 5,
    "zorath": 5,
    "holwyn": 10,
}

MEMO — Branch Managers

Starting next quarter, tier-one customer support for the Quillon product line will transition to Averlane Services, our selected outsourcing partner. Branch support staff will shift to escalations and on-site work; no redundancies are planned at branch level. Training for the handover runs over the next six weeks, coordinated by regional operations. Customer-facing messaging will be supplied centrally—do not improvise. The commercial reasoning, which must stay internal, is noted below.

board note of bajop-yaweg: The western region missed its Pelys quota by 58.0 percent last quarter. Pelysek Foods plans to raise the Belius list price by 44.0 percent in July. The steering committee signed off on a budget of $133.8 million for Project Pelax. The renewal with Zoraelix Systems closes at $61.9 million a year, 12.7 percent above the last contract.